James Edgar Dailey 52 of Huntington, WV died March 30, 2004 at St. Mary’s Medical Center. He was a Baptist by faith and was a 1970 graduate of Huntington East High School.

He was preceded in death by his brother Philip Dailey; grandfather Joe Short; grandmother Nellie Waldron and father in-law Junius Doss.

He is survived by his Mother and Father James E. and Joyce Dailey of Huntington; Son and Daughter in-law Chad and Jamey Dailey of Huntington; Daughter and Son in-law Kara and Barry (Scooter) Cremeans of Lavalette, WV; Brother and Sister in-law Stephen and Teresa Dailey of Milton, WV; Sister and Brother in-law Sandra and Barry Martin of Teays Valley; Grandmother Mary Short of Hurricane; Grandsons Corey, Cody, Cameron Cremeans; Nieces Sarah Hall, Jessica Haynes, Brittany and Amy Martin; Special Friends Clarice Doss, Sonny Bailey, Ron Nicely and Tom Stough.

Services will be held Friday April 2 11:00am at Beard Mortuary, Huntington with Rev. Edwin Harper officiating. Burial will be in Enon Cemetery, Salt Rock.

Friends may call 6-8pm Thursday at the mortuary.
